New Glasgow Police Service respond to a call about unexploded ammunition shells in New Glasgow’s business district on Thursday, July 5.
Police received the call at approximately 1:30 p.m. after construction staff located two ammunition shells in an abandoned building that was in the process of being demolished.
New Glasgow Police Service and the Department of National Defence Explosive Ordinance Unit responded to the abandoned building located on Provost Street New Glasgow.
The National Defense Explosive Ordinance Unit removed the two ammunition shells safety from the location. New Glasgow Police Service continue to investigate.
